## Runbook: Flaky integration tests — Paylark service

Symptom: intermittent failures in the settlement suite, usually timeouts against the mock ledger. First: rerun once. Still failing? Check that PAYLARK_LEDGER_TIMEOUT_MS is 8000, not the old 2000 default. Verify MOCK_LEDGER_SEED is pinned — unpinned seeds cause order-dependent failures. Clear the fixture cache with the reset script before escalating. The test harness also authenticates against the sandbox gateway, and that credential lives in the env file on the line below.

vault entry, kafog-yahop: COURIER_KEY8=0faa53ae

## Locker access flow

When a Tumblenest customer scans their pickup code, the gateway validates it against the reservation service, then pulses the locker latch for six seconds. If the latch fails twice, the order flags for staff override. Don't modify timeout values without checking with the site lead. The gateway reads its runtime settings from the block below.

service settings:
[casax]
port = 6379
team = rusir
host = casax.zemvarhq.corp
region = outer-4
access_code = ac_9808ce
timeout_ms = 1500

MEMO — Dept Heads

Quick heads-up: we're overhauling the Sunleaf Rewards programme starting next quarter. Points accrual moves to tiered spend bands, and the old birthday voucher goes away (yes, finally). Marta's team will circulate the migration plan by Friday. One thing stays under wraps for now, so keep this next bit to yourselves.

board note of tadup-tajog: Headcount on the Oliiel team goes from 31 to 88 by the end of February. Gross margin on Oliiel came in at 62 percent against a plan of 29 percent.